Maintaining consistent forced-air and hydronic building loops across the Capital Region requires advanced mechanical testing instrumentation rather than uncalibrated visual guesswork. Minor line wear inside an industrial rooftop unit (RTU) compressor or a dirty air economizer switch can restrict total building static movement, causing unexpected automatic lockouts or severe mechanical component fractures during extreme sub-zero weather drop periods. When you lock in an on-demand technical deployment through our central core, our journeyman HVAC mechanics systematically verify safety limit controls and match OEM part requirements to restore facility operations safe and clean.
The final balance of a facility climate maintenance contract depends explicitly on machine tons, part availability, safety controls configuration, and repair labor complexity. For example, high-tonnage variable air volume (VAV) components require highly specialized digital diagnostic calibration compared to older single-stage atmospheric warehouse unit heaters. Processing replaced electronic control modules, mercury-based thermostat components, and heavy sheet metal scrap requires absolute alignment with provincial environmental safety standards. To keep up with our local preservation values, our service trucks route all failed components and reclaimed scrap metals directly to authorized regional recycling platforms, such as the Ambleside and Kennedale Eco Stations. Working in strict accordance with the *City of Edmonton Waste Management Guidelines* ensures hazardous materials are safely processed without damaging delicate local river habitats.
Additionally, all field technicians perform maintenance under the strict oversight of **Alberta Occupational Health and Safety (OHS)** workspace protocols. Our crews utilize certified personal voltage detectors, implement secure high-pressure fuel line isolation runs, and position high-visibility warning markers in active service zones to prevent property damage during repair processes.
